Infrastructure Software Engineer

 Vocalocity, a leading provider of cloud-based business phone systems, is seeking a motivated engineer to join the core development team based in Atlanta. The successful candidate will join an energetic team and a fast-growing organization, and will help develop telephony platform and services for cloud-based and mobile solutions. Team members are expected to demonstrate creativity and initiative, and must be self-motivating with ability to work independently and with minimal managerial oversight.

Primary roles and responsibilities for this position include:

  • Implement requirements as defined by the business quickly in a collaborative fashion, with a high degree of quality.
  • Participate in the complete agile development process including planning, design/architecture and demo sessions.
  • Evaluate new technologies and techniques for incorporation into products and processes.
  • Research, review and repair legacy code.
  • Respond promptly and professionally to bug reports.
  • Strong and effective inter-personal and commun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se group of customers and staff.
  • Provide assistance to testers and support personnel as needed to determine system problems.
  • Test code to ensure that logic and syntax are correct, and that code results are accurate.

Skills and experience for this position include:

  • 3+ years experience in software development
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science
  • Strong experience in Java, especially in a multi-threaded server environment
  • Strong experience in Linux/Unix
  • Strong experience or knowledge of REST protocols, Tomcat and/or JBoss, and Subversion
  • Experience with Virtualization and Cloud vendors APIs a plus
  • Experience working with SQL
  • Experience in SIP, especially in a telephony context a plus
  • Experience with CCXML or VXML a plus
  • Experience with Spring or Ibatis a plus
  • Experience with alternate languages on the JVM (Groovy, Scala, etc) a plus
  • Experience working with Continuous Integration tools (i.e. CruiseControl, Hudson) a plus
  • Experience in a DevOps environment a plus
